Having “cut his teeth” in the “Jazz Warriors” of the early 90’s, award-winning saxophonist Tony Kofi has gone on to establish himself as a musician, teacher and composer of some authority. As well as “Nu-Troop” and “Jazz Jamaica” Tony’s alto playing has also been a feature of many bands and artists he has worked with include “US-3” Branford Marsalis, Courtney Pine, Donald Byrd, Eddie Henderson, The David Murray Big Band and Sam Rivers. His fluent and fiery hard-bop alto playing is constantly in demand and it’s with great pleasure that we welcome him to the Hideaway this evening where he will play a mix of originals as well as a tribute to Charlie Parker.
